Box 580 Kens/, AK 99669 Subjects East Al/ak & Righbush Street Improvements, Proposal Construction Administration and Project Surveying EeL th: We appreciate the opportunity to submit this proposal to provide complete Construction Administration services for the referenced project. We propose to provide all inspection, coordination, quantity computations, testing, field engineering and surveying on a time and expense basis, to complete this project. No~thern Test Lab viii provide all testing services and Mike Swan will provide a portion of the project surveying. Survey work that requires a level or transit instrument viii be paid at the current State of Alaska Title 36 pay rates. We have inclUded cOsts for Project Engineering involving interpretation of the' Construction Documents and other items requiring additional technical knowledge. We have attempted to keep Engineer time to a minimum by providing an ex~erienced field engineer who will be able to handle day to day construction related issues. We anticipate a site visit at least once per week by the l~oJect Engineer resulting in approximately 2 hours per week during construction. The estimated fee is based on a project length of 25, 10-hour, work days per discussion with contractor and our evaluation of the probable schedule. The contract allows for a longer contract time and if the contractor takes more than the foregoing estimates the cost could be more. The project inspecto~ will be Henry ~nackstedt, an experienced design and field engineer who is knowledgeable in overall construction including road projects. Because the majority of this street .project deals with grading, excavation, and paving, his field.engineering and soils experience will prove valuable.
